Synopsis
A team of public servants has come to an escape room for team-building exercises, but when they find that the room they have to escape is our current socio-political situation, they begin to daydream about 16-hour work weeks, universal basic incomes, and technologies that would make the current status quo obsolete. The stage is modeled on a Monopoly board, with a golden throne for the winner. Through a series of games, social and political questions are examined, and the performers are challenged to invent new games of their own in order to find a way out.
Presented as part of the Aufstand der Utopien (Rise of the Utopias) festival from Unent_eckte Narrative.

Press
"The four perfectly cast, dynamic young actors are quick-witted and switched-on … they ponder about religion and culture, debate hotly, and go to battle in slow-motion. Until the 'Tabula Rasa' makes clear, completely unpretentiously, that in the end the only way out is to work together. Theatre can hardly be more valuable."
Sebastian Steger, Chemnitzer Freie Presse
"A consistently brisk performance … which works surprisingly well thanks to the lively, likeable and often clever interventions of the playing quartet — all of them really athletically dynamic."
Dresdner Neueste Nachrichten
